Break-glass access: SquatWatch

Quick notes for the weekly sync. SquatWatch is our typo-squatting package scanner; if it goes dark, malicious lookalike packages can slip into the Pellbrook registry, so we keep a break-glass path. Use it only when both regular admins are unreachable and the scanner has been down 30+ minutes. Grab the sealed envelope from the ops locker, log the incident in #squatwatch-alerts, and ping whoever's on call. The break-glass login prompts for the passphrase below.

unlock words, tagaf-tawif: quenys-zordor-aldius-caswyn

**Ticket #4482 — Vault locked during blue-green cutover**

Hey plugin folks — heads up that the Lumicent billing worker got stuck mid-swap last night. The green side came up fine, but the secrets vault auto-locked when health checks flapped, so any plugin calling the charge API will see 503s until we unseal. Don't retry aggressively; the queue drains once we're back. If your plugin caches tokens, flush them after the cutover completes. To unseal the standby vault, use the passphrase below.

unlock words, yawig-kagef: gordor-holvan-ulaael-pramir-ulaiel-tamdor

Subject: Quickstore 4.2 — bloom filter now fronts the KV layer

Plugin authors: starting with this release, Quickstore places a bloom filter ahead of the key-value store. Negative lookups return faster; false positives fall through safely. No API changes are required on your side. Verify your plugin against the staging build referenced below.

session token of fahif-tadup = htk3_9c7